An indictment was filed Friday against cousins Khalil and Jamil Jabarin from Jisr az-Zarqa for weapons offenses, shooting in a residential area, and attempted aggravated assault, according to N12. The indictment alleges the two attacked their neighbor in July over a dispute about mats placed in an alley.
